Don't be different just for different's sake. If you see it differently, function that way. Follow your own muse, always.
Interpretation
Be true to yourself and your own perspective rather than conforming for the sake of being unique.
Morgan Freeman's quote emphasizes the importance of authenticity and individuality. He suggests that one should not strive to be different merely for the sake of standing out; instead, one should embrace their unique viewpoint and express it genuinely, allowing their true self to guide their actions and decisions.
